Simplified 2021 Statistical Area Level 2 (SA2) polygon boundaries for the SA2 codes used in Tourism Research Australia exports. Representative interior-point coordinates are included for analyses that need one point per SA2.

Usage

oz_sa2

Format

An sf data frame with 2,350 rows and 4 variables: * **sa2_code_tra**: Integer SA2 identifier used by Tourism Research Australia. This field can be joined to tourism_reason, tourism_activity, and tourism_region. * **lat**: Latitude of a representative point located within the SA2, in decimal degrees. * **lon**: Longitude of a representative point located within the SA2, in decimal degrees. * **geometry**: Simplified SA2 polygon or multipolygon geometry in GDA2020 (EPSG:7844).

Source

Australian Bureau of Statistics, ASGS Edition 3 digital boundary files.

Details

Boundaries were obtained from the Australian Bureau of Statistics ASGS Edition 3 digital boundary files. Full-resolution polygons were matched to TRA codes by state and SA2 name. Representative points were calculated from the full-resolution geometry in Australian Albers (EPSG:3577), using a point guaranteed to lie on the SA2 surface. Polygon geometry was simplified with rmapshaper, retaining five percent of removable vertices while preserving shapes and shared boundaries.
